Consider This: The Complex Story Behind An Oft-Repeated Statistic On Boston's Racial Wealth Gap
ResumeEight dollars. It's one of the most mentioned statistics in Massachusetts politics.
A 2015 study found the median net worth for white households in Greater Boston was a quarter million dollars. For Black families, it was just $8.
Yet few people know the figure comes with important caveats — or the full story of how it became so well known.
